#3d244f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3d244f is composed of 23.9% red, 14.1%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 274.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.4% and a lightness of 22.5%. #3d244f color hex could be obtained by blending #7a489e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3d244f color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
The hexadecimal color #3d244f has RGB values of R:61, G:36,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 4006991.
